Concord was not able to break out of their rough patch on Thursday as the team picked up their fourth straight loss. They fell 3-0 to the Miramonte Matadors. The result was an unpleasant reminder to Concord of the 4-3 defeat they experienced in the pair's previous head-to-head fixture last Tuesday.
Jarod Bennett sp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: he surrendered three earned runs on seven hits and racked up ten Ks. He has been consistent recently: he hasn't pitched less than five innings in four consecutive pitching appearances.
Concord's loss dropped their record down to 5-11. As for Miramonte, they are on a roll lately: they've won three of their last four matchups, which provided a nice bump to their 7-10 record this season.
Concord will head out on the road to take on Alhambra at 4: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Alhambra's pitching crew has only allowed 2.7 runs per game this season, so Concord's hitters will have their work cut out for them. As for Miramonte, they will look to defend their home field on Monday against Novato at 4:00 p.m.
